H-1B Dependent Employer: Wake up and Act OR What Do You Do After You Have Been Hit on the Head?
On January 19, 2001, the long-awaited regulations on Labor Conditioning Applications were finally adopted by the Department of Labor. Reading the 245-page document put me in a trance-like state, and when I finally came back to my senses, the bells went off: OH MY GOD! SOME OF MY CLIENTS ARE H-1B DEPENDENT! It is not that we did not know the regulations were coming. It is not that we did not advise our clients as soon as we started working on our first H-1B for them; we told them that they should do certain things to prevent the blow of being declared "H-1B Dependent" ...
